Allow depreciation to be calculated on negative assets
When a negative fixed asset is acquired, you must set "allow negative net book value" on the fixed asset. However, when a negative fixed asset is depreciated Dynamics 365 for Finance and Operations cannot calculate a depreciation proposal. The periodic depreciation therefore must be calculated...
Thrilled to announce this feature released in 2022 Release Wave 1 APP 10.0.24.

IFRS16 - Leased Assets
A new international accounting standard for leased assets (IFRS16) has requirements to capitalise all leases regardless of whether they are financial or operating leases.
Microsoft have advised via the IFRS support document (
Glad to share with you the ongoing incorporation effort to include Asset leasing module under Microsoft Dynamics 365 Finance to support IFRS 16 and US GAAP ASC 842.

Reversing the depreciation is not updating the fields 'Date when depreciation was last run' and 'depreciation periods remaining' in the asset book
After posting the depreciation for a fixed asset the values in the fields 'Date when depreciation was last run' and 'Depreciation periods remaining' are getting updated in the Asset Books. But when this depreciation transaction is reversed, these 2 fields are not getting back the original valu...
Glad to share with you the Date when depreciation was last run and depreciation periods remaining are updated in case of reversing depreciation transaction.
